When d'andre was 5 months old, he looked at a toy train, but when his view of the train was blocked, he did not search for it. n
iVinArrow [24]
<span>The right answer is Object Permanence. This is the ability that allows the brain of the human being to understand that an object still exists even if it cannot be seen or felt. <span>Humans are not born with this ability, it is acquired when the brain matures between 9 and 12 months approximately.

An incident at the nuclear power plant involving the unintentional release of radiological material has occurred. in what hazard
Mekhanik [1.2K]

The incident would be characterized as technological hazard. Technological hazard is defined as a hazard where it covers the potential hazard that may be bad for the people and the environment. These include, toxic waste, nuclear radiation, dam failure, transport and technological accidents.
